Had a great day at Bundy Hill saturday with friends from BorderLine4x4,GL4x4 and Ranger-Forums! First time out in the B2 since last year and only a few things have changed since then biggest being stepping up to 35" tires and wow did they make a huge difference.Truck went everywhere I pointed it,over top anything in front of it,never got hung up or stuck once all day.
More importantly for me the day was about Dawns first time out as a driver of her own rig. She has a 03 Liberty that we have done a few cheap upgrades to that would allow her to keep up with most of the boys.So far it has a budget 2.5" lift,31" MTR's and my homemade front recovery points.Next upgrade will be a rear locker for sure.
Biggest concern was getting her to trust her spotters and just get over her fears of being on 3 wheels and being way off camber! All I can say is by the end of the day I couldnt have been more proud of her!

The Twin Beam front ends are decent except for massive camber changes during articulation. My is the Dana35 and with some minor mods it flexes very well up front....that said I do have a D44 straight axle waiting to go under it very soon.

My take on Bundy Hill is that it's a cool place to go if you live within a couple of hours. I don't know that I would personally travel the 4+ hours for a weekend trip there. It's only a fraction of the size that Badlands is... I would guess 1/4 the size. I'm not convinced that there's enough to do for an entire weekend without hitting the same obstacles multiple times... not that I had a problem doing that. :rolleyes: :D I'd definitely go again for the day if I was back in that area.
